Eliminations had very few cars turnout, only 7 in AWD. I beat Bill at MAP on my first round, Bill's car is quick but he wasn't super consistent all day so I had no idea what to expect. Luckily I beat him as I FORGOT to shift to fourth, I bounced away at 8500rpm in third thinking I was in fourth waiting for the 1/4 to end. Bill went 11.837@124.24 with a R/T.577 and 2.113 60' to my 11.247@122.49 R/T .313 and 1.680 60'. Bill's a super cool dude, his car seems it can run a ten with some more dialing in.

Round two I was paired up with AJ in his 1g DSM, no one wanted to race him since he was running mid 10's all day at upper 130's I think he had the best AWD ET in trials a 10.5! AJ went 10.668@137.71 R/T .634 and 1.825 60' to my 11.142@125.49 R/T .149 and 1.720 60'. Luckily I was able to tree him for the win, I only beat him by .0112.

Brad and I were in the final and he was starting to get real quick with a 10.8 earlier and or low elevens. Our R/Ts were close and we were side by side most of the run. I shifted a little quicker so I could stay slightly ahead but once he got into fourth he motored right by and I decided to let off cause no way I was going to catch him. No shit I wasn't going to catch him he was going 140mph! Damn nice B-rad!
My time 11.215@122.40 R/T .171 60' 1.709 to Brad's 10.921@140.77 R/T .213 60'1.745


OK couple things I found out about my car. ACT HD pressure plate and 6 puck sprung clutch is best clutch I have ever run. Takes the abuse and gives me lightning fast shifts at over 8,000 rpms, never missed a gear on my last 8-10 passes. Clutch took all the abuse of launches and never slipped. Truthfully this is the first drag event, let alone two day event, were I never even thought about how my clutch was doing. Clutch was and still is a champ! 14k miles on it so far

6-speeds suck for the power level I am at with their short ass gearing, I either need power to go 130+ to really make use of fifth or run 4th out to 9K. Shifting to fifth never netted me better than an 11.3@~122mph. Bumped the RPM up from 8K - 8.5K and I held onto fourth through the traps on the next run. This netted me an 11.148@125.42mph however it still wasn't enough RPM as I was bouncing off the 8500 limiter before end of track. Didn't have the stones to bump it up higher as FP doesn't recommend over 8K on stock springs and retainers. Ran a lot of 11.1 125-126mph runs. Car had an 11.0 for sure in it.


Thanks everyone for the awesome weekend, MAP for putting on the event and making a fun weekend. Gotta thank DB Performance for help with recommending parts for my setup and track support. This evo has 53K on the clock, 47K of which has a DB tune on E85 at ~30psi levels at all times, still rocking the original head gasket and head bolts and I really feel this success is a direct result of Shane's tuning with E85.
